    Why Dasara celebrations at Mysore Palace is a must-watch

    A looks at the grand Dasara celebrations at the Mysore palace:

    Where: Mysore
    When: September 20 to 4 October, 2014

    Bangalore Mysore Palace is well illuminated during Dasara as the Mysore Dasara Festival takes place. There are numerous music and dance performances at the Palace. Mysore Dasara also features a food and film festival, heritage walk, flower show and sightseeing.

    This year the festival dates are from September 25 to 4 October. Also it will be the first time that the ceremonial welcome will be conducted at the Aranya Bhavan instead of the Mysore Palace. Last year, the music festival at Mysore Palace scripted a new history when fusion music played by Louis Banks, who is regarded as the godfather of Indian jazz, won the hearts of the audience.

    Indian and western music instruments were played for over two hours. The organisers have put in extra effort to have green celebrations this year. The chief guests at this 10 day event will be honoured by saplings, books and art instead of garlands or bouquets. Apart from the many first’s at the event this year, the managing committee has also decided to extend information about various events on an instant messaging subscription service.

    In terms of security, the police will use a helicopter to watch crowds during Jamboo Savari (the traditional Dasara procession). So be there to witness a blend of tradition, royalty and great music.
